  • Abstract
    TDM have been got the better profitability for a long time. The PWE3 provides a method for retaining this high return service, at the same time migrating TDM towards IP/MPLS packet transport network. Transport MPLS is the most promising technology for packet transport network. In this paper, the architecture and key technology of pseudo wires emulation edge to edge for TDM over transport MPLS is introduced. The function of each plane and relative modules are also analyzed. In the end, the simulation and verification results will be given in the conclusions.
